Cybersecurity deal activity (excl. US) declined 6% in 2022 whilst investment increased 15%
• Overall, there were 291 CyberTech deals announced outside the US in 2022, a 4% decline from 2021
• CyberTech companies headquartered outside the US raised a combined $3.9bn in 2022, 15% higher than 2021 levels

Swiss Re has reported that natural disasters resulted global economic losses of $275bn in 2022, of which $125 billion were covered by insurance, reaffirming a trend of 5-7% annual increases.

Chubb has unveiled new underwriting criteria for oil and gas extraction projects that will require clients to reduce methane emissions, a byproduct of oil and gas production that are among the most severe greenhouse gases.
